jíst is a common verb in Czech meaning to eat. It is used to describe the act of consuming food, from a bite to a meal, and appears in everyday speech, literature, and media. The verb is imperfective, indicating an ongoing, repeated, or habitual action, and it forms broader verbal expressions related to meals and eating habits.
